[[WikiWiki]] is easy and fun.&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
* Hit the Edit button to edit any page.&lt;br /&gt;
* Click the question mark on an undefine page [[ToDefineThePage]].&lt;br /&gt;
* Click the page title to see backlinks to any page.&lt;br /&gt;
* Click the [[PhpWiki]] logo top right to return to the [[HomePage]] at any time.&lt;br /&gt;

Q: I saw manifestations like:&lt;br /&gt;
&amp;quot;http wiki implementations&amp;quot;, which were automatically(?) googled for.  how&lt;br /&gt;
do I do that?  also, can I use [[InterWiki]] names? google:wiki implementations&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
A: [[Google:wiki implementations]]&lt;br /&gt;
&amp;#039;&amp;#039;Google needs brackets because it is not a [[WikiWord]] (Google only has one Capital).  see the [[InterWikiMap]] for all [[InterWiki]] connections with proper Capitalization.&amp;#039;&amp;#039;&lt;br /&gt;
